What is the difference between From Home Remote Data Visualization vs From Home Remote Data Analyst?

AspectFrom Home Remote Data VisualizationFrom Home Remote Data Analyst
Required SkillsData visualization tools (Tableau, Power BI), data storytellingData analysis, statistical skills, Excel, SQL
Work EnvironmentRemote, project-based, collaborativeRemote, analytical, reporting-focused
Industry UsageMarketing, business intelligence, UX designFinance, healthcare, research

While both roles often work remotely and require data skills, Data Visualization specialists focus on creating visual representations of data to communicate insights, whereas Data Analysts perform broader data analysis, including statistical evaluation and reporting. The roles overlap in skills like data tools but differ in primary focus and output.

Is data visualization in high demand?

Data visualization roles, including remote data visualization jobs, are in high demand as organizations seek to interpret complex data effectively. Skills in tools like Tableau, Power BI, or Python are often required, and the ability to communicate insights visually is highly valued across industries.

Data Analyst
Full-Time | Hybrid (potential for remote)

The Data Analyst plays an important role on the Analytics Team at Northeast Kingdom Human Services (NKHS) by supporting agency-wide data needs. Under the supervision of the Data Scientist, this position is responsible for gathering, cleaning, analyzing, and reporting on data from NKHS’s electronic medical record (EMR) system and other sources. The Data Analyst works collaboratively with clinical and administrative teams to ensure data is accurate, meaningful, and supports informed decision-making across the organization. 

Primary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
• Extract, clean, analyze, and summarize data from multiple sources
• Prepare reports and data summaries for a variety of audiences
• Create dashboards and visualizations to highlight key metrics and trends
• Collaborate with the Quality Improvement team to monitor data quality and accuracy
• Support recurring and ad hoc reporting needs
• Contribute to the development and standardization of data analysis and data management best practices
• Assist the Data Scientist with statistical modeling projects, including data preprocessing, visualization, and validation of results
• Maintain compliance with data privacy, security, and ethical standards

Position Qualifications:
• Bachelor’s degree in Statistics, Mathematics, Computer Science, or a related field
• One to three (1–3) years of experience in data analysis or a related field
• Strong proficiency in SQL
• Advanced Excel skills
• Proficiency in a programming language used for data analysis (e.g., R or Python)
• Experience with data visualization tools such as Tableau or Power BI
• Familiarity with version control systems such as Git
• Understanding of basic statistical theory and data analysis techniques
•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ail
• Ability to communicate data findings to both technical and non-technical audiences
• Experience with non-profit, social impact, or human services organizations preferred
• Experience with program evaluation or impact assessment preferred
